One of the many alter egos of James Thirlwell. This odd name comes from the "band"-names Thirlwell used, like Scraping Foetus off The Wheel, You've got Foetus on Your Breath, Foetus uber Frisco, Foetus Interruptus etc etc. I guess record stores got fed up with all these names and started filing everything under Foetus...

The latest "solo" project from Foetus is Gash, an album released under the name "Foetus", plain and simple.

Also a variant spelling of fetus. Apparently, this spelling arose after some 19th century British writers popularized this way of spelling it. Unfortunately, the spelling stuck and is still in widespread use today.

Etymologically, the word arises from the Latin fetus and thus fetus is the correct spelling.
